Derbyshire Cricket Club Reports £11k Profit in 2024 Amid On-Field Challenges

Derbyshire Cricket Club announces £11k pre-tax profit for 2024 while facing on-field struggles in County Championship Division Two.

Derbyshire County Cricket Club has reported a pre-tax profit of £11,000 for 2024, marking their 11th profitable year in the past 12 seasons. The financial success comes despite the team's disappointing bottom-place finish in the 2023 County Championship.

Financial Highlights

  • Sold-out T20 Blast matches against Nottinghamshire and Yorkshire
  • Successful 'Midlands Mania' double-header at Edgbaston
  • Record investment in cricket operations while maintaining profitability
  • Club remains completely debt-free

On-Field Performance

While financially stable, Derbyshire struggled competitively:

  • Finished last in County Championship Division Two in 2023
  • Continued challenges competing with wealthier county clubs
  • Maintaining balanced approach between financial prudence and playing budget investment

Leadership Statements

Club chairman Ian Morgan emphasized:

"Being debt-free allows us to safeguard our future, but we must work harder off-field to support on-field success. The financial gap with larger counties grows, but we remain committed to smart investments in our squad."

2024 Season Outlook

  • Season opener: vs Gloucestershire on April 4
  • Wayne Madsen returns as captain for second stint
  • New signing Ghazanfar (spin bowler) joins for T20 Blast campaign

Key Challenges Ahead

  1. Improving Championship performance while maintaining finances
  2. Developing competitive squad within budget constraints
  3. Sustaining fan engagement through successful T20 campaigns
